2006 Alfa Romeo 156 vs. 2006 Suzuki Grand Vitara

To start off, both 2006 Alfa Romeo 156 and 2006 Suzuki Grand Vitara were released in the same year (2006). Therefore the support and the availability on parts for both vehicles should be relatively similar. At 2,734 cc (6 cylinders), 2006 Suzuki Grand Vitara is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2006 Alfa Romeo 156 (173 HP @ 4000 RPM) has 2 more horse power than 2006 Suzuki Grand Vitara. (171 HP @ 3300 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2006 Alfa Romeo 156 should accelerate faster than 2006 Suzuki Grand Vitara.

Let's talk about torque, 2006 Alfa Romeo 156 (385 Nm @ 2000 RPM) has 154 more torque (in Nm) than 2006 Suzuki Grand Vitara. (231 Nm @ 3300 RPM). This means 2006 Alfa Romeo 156 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2006 Suzuki Grand Vitara.
